1. A method for assigning call priority in a packet switched environment, comprising:

  • receiving a request from an internet protocol phone within the packet switched environment to establish a connection to a dialed number, the internet protocol phone having a wired connection to the packet switched environment;

    determining a priority for the connection based on the dialed number;

    generating a priority certificate based on the priority;

    attaching the priority certificate to the communication packets of the connection;

    establishing the connection based on the priority;

    monitoring use by an end-point of connections having an augmented priority; and

    modifying the priority of the connection based on the monitored end-point use of connections having an augmented priority.
